About The Role

To spearhead our commitment to being a future facing firm, using best in practice legal tech to support our colleagues and better serve our clients. To lead the new GenAI legal tech product capability including setting the strategy for how we can increase value in this category. This will include working with the practice groups, Product Managers for other categories, especially the Product Manager for AI and Document Review, the wider Innovation and Legal Operations & Project Management teams to create practice group implementation plans, learning & development materials, and practice specific use cases. This will also include working with lawyers across the business to create a super user network to further embed the use of these tools in practice.

Responsibilities:

  • Working with senior stakeholders to help deliver the firm GenAI strategy from a product management perspective.
  • Working with the Legal Tech R&D Manager to source and assess new systems for suitability.
  • On-boarding and rolling out new GenAI products as they come in to the business.
  • Providing training and support to lawyers and staff on how to use GenAI products effectively and efficiently.
  • Maintaining the firm’s GenAI risk register entries, adding to and amending them as necessary.
  • Being the technical subject matter expert in the use of GenAI tools on a range of client matters, to lead demos of these tools and suggest appropriate use cases for new matters.
  • Defining the ideal workflow when interacting with GenAI platforms, from cradle to grave of matters and research, incorporating different users and stakeholders involved.
  • Reviewing and updating use cases for when these tools should be considered on a matter, as well as developing specific use cases on a per tool, per practice group basis.
  • Creating a bank of case studies to help express value of the tool to new users.
  • Reviewing and updating training materials for tools in the category, including e-learning opportunities, practice specific guidance notes and firm wide learning & development sessions.
  • Collating value metrics of tools within this space to be able to express and quantify the benefits working with them can bring.
  • Taking the lead on account management responsibilities, working with customer success teams from our suppliers as well as the CMS internal teams on technical requirements and sign off for functionality of the tools.
  • Working with the Head of Legal Tech, taking the lead on supplier negotiations, on-boarding and renewals, as well as the budget process for the category.
  • Facilitating creation of new CMS products incorporating the use of GenAI tools in practice, working with lawyers across the firm to develop the products and create marketing materials to pitch them to clients.
  • Updating and maintaining pitch wording and language for how CMS express the use of GenAI to new clients, including case studies of how we have used them for current clients.
  • Working alongside the legal technologists on the Legal Tech Tools Team, to help train them up on ideal working practices when working with lawyers and customising specific tools, to help them scope out new projects.
  • Acting as an escalation point should any issues arise where we need to work with the supplier to rectify.
  • Keeping abreast of any market changes and new tools within this space, working with the wider Legal Tech Product Team to consider for testing and piloting internally.
